import FirebaseAuth
import FirebaseAuthUIComponents
import FirebaseCore
import SwiftUI
@MainActor
public struct EmailLinkView {
@Environment(AuthService.self) private var authService
@Environment(\.accountConflictHandler) private var accountConflictHandler
@Environment(\.reportError) private var reportError
@State private var email = ""
@State private var showAlert = false
public init() {}
private func sendEmailLink() async throws {
do {
try await authService.sendEmailSignInLink(email: email)
showAlert = true
} catch {
if let errorHandler = reportError {
errorHandler(error)
} else {
throw error
}
}
}
}
extension EmailLinkView: View {
public var body: some View {
VStack(spacing: 24) {
AuthTextField(
text: $email,
label: authService.string.signInLinkEmailFieldLabel,
prompt: authService.string.emailInputLabel,
keyboardType: .emailAddress,
contentType: .emailAddress,
validations: [
FormValidators.email,
],
leading: {
Image(systemName: "at")
}
)
Button {
Task {
try await sendEmailLink()
authService.emailLink = email
}
} label: {
Text(authService.string.sendEmailLinkButtonLabel)
.padding(.vertical, 8)
.frame(maxWidth: .infinity)
}
.buttonStyle(.borderedProminent)
.disabled(!CommonUtils.isValidEmail(email))
.padding([.top, .bottom], 8)
.frame(maxWidth: .infinity)
}
.frame(maxWidth: .infinity, maxHeight: .infinity, alignment: .top)
.navigationTitle(authService.string.signInWithEmailLinkViewTitle)
.safeAreaPadding()
.alert(
authService.string.signInWithEmailLinkViewTitle,
isPresented: $showAlert
) {
Button(authService.string.okButtonLabel) {
showAlert = false
}
} message: {
Text(authService.string.signInWithEmailLinkViewMessage)
}
.onOpenURL { url in
Task {
do {
try await authService.handleSignInLink(url: url)
} catch {
reportError?(error)
if case let AuthServiceError.accountConflict(ctx) = error,
let onConflict = accountConflictHandler {
onConflict(ctx)
return
}
throw error
}
}
}
}
}
#Preview {
FirebaseOptions.dummyConfigurationForPreview()
return EmailLinkView()
.environment(AuthService())
}
